Q: Is 484,463 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 484,463 is not a prime number.

Why is 484,463 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 484463 can be evenly divided by 1 7 49 9,887 69,209 and 484,463, with no remainder.

Since 484,463 cannot be divided by just 1 and 484,463, it is not a prime number.
